Databricks is looking for a talented and experienced Senior Corporate Counsel to join our expanding Legal team. This position will report to our Senior Managing Counsel, Corporate, and is a unique opportunity to advise on and drive a broad range of corporate matters, including governance, M&A and venture transactions, public company readiness and securities law compliance and subsidiary management, and to provide business-focused legal advice to stakeholders throughout Databricks on a daily basis.
You will be agile, highly organized and have the skills, drive and flexibility to support and accelerate a leading technology company, addressing novel legal issues and organizational challenges. A successful candidate will be a resourceful self-starter, comfortable working in a fast-paced and dynamic environment and excellent at building strong relationships.
Responsibilities
- Support all phases of corporate transactions, including M&A, ventures and equity and capital raising transactions
- Support public company readiness and securities law compliance initiatives
- Develop, implement and continuously improve disclosure controls and procedures in coordination with finance, investor relations and other internal stakeholders
- Prepare and review board and committee materials and advise on board-related governance matters
- Prepare governance and compliance policies and procedures, including updates to such policies and procedures
- Review and advise internal stakeholders with respect to investor presentations, offering materials, public announcements, press releases, and other corporate communications
- Support ESG and sustainability reporting initiatives as needed, with a focus on corporate-governance, disclosure and public-company reporting considerations
- Advise on antitrust and competition law aspects of M&A, as well as provide global antitrust and competition counseling.
- Lead international subsidiary management, including formation and maintenance of domestic and international subsidiaries
- Establish and execute OKRs to continuously improve processes for scaling legal support for general corporate matters
- Develop and maintain relationships with internal and external stakeholders, including finance, corporate development, marketing, investor relations and outside counsel
Basic Qualifications and Experience
- 8+ years of experience at a nationally-recognized law firm, a public company or a combination of both
- J.D. from a top-tier law school
- Member of a state bar in good standing
- You have substantial experience advising public and/or high-growth private companies on corporate governance, securities law compliance, SEC reporting or IPO readiness and corporate transactions
- You possess strong interpersonal skills and ability to form relationships with key stakeholders
- You can perform and thrive in a fast-paced, deadline-intensive environment and enjoy being continually challenged
- You are a self-starter with the capability to operate independently and to interact confidently with senior management when required
- You have a strong work ethic, excellent organizational skills and can manage many cross-functional projects simultaneously with minimal supervision

Databricks is a cloud-based data platform that specializes in providing solutions for data engineering, machine learning, and analytics. Founded in 2013 by the original creators of Apache Spark, the company enables organizations to unify data processing and analysis workflows, facilitating collaboration for data professionals. Databricks offers an integrated environment for data scientists, engineers, and business analysts, streamlining the process of building and deploying AI and data-driven applications. With a strong emphasis on simplifying big data management, Databricks helps businesses harness the power of their data to drive innovation and insights.
